Here's the NBC Sports piece - (LINK)
"Mesko’s signing could well mean the Steelers will be replacing Drew Butler, who handled the punting duties in 2012 and beat out veteran Brian Moorman this summer. Butler posted a gross average of 43.8 yards and a net average of 37.8 yards a season ago."
It does mention also that Drew Butler was waived about 45 minutes ago too. Good to see Mesko land somewhere very quickly, just as we thought he might.
